What Are Prescription Drugs?
Prescription drugs are medications that require a composed order from a certified healthcare supplier, such as a physician, dentist, or nurse specialist. These medications are typically more powerful or possibly damaging than over-the-counter drugs, requiring expert oversight to guarantee safe and efficient use.

Why Are Prescription Drugs Necessary?
Prescription drugs are developed to treat particular health conditions, prevent illness, or relieve signs that patients might experience. Some reasons for prescribing medication include:
- Managing chronic conditions (e.g., diabetes, hypertension)
- Treating intense health problems (e.g., bacterial infections)
- Providing pain relief (e.g., postoperative pain, arthritis)
- Correcting hormonal imbalances (e.g., thyroid medications)
- Managing mental health disorders (e.g., antidepressants)
Types of Prescription Drugs
There are various classifications of prescription drugs, classified based upon their pharmacological effects and usages. Below is a table summarizing the most common categories:
| Category | Description | Examples |
|---|---|---|
| Antibiotics | Treat bacterial infections | Amoxicillin, Ciprofloxacin |
| Antidepressants | Manage signs of anxiety and stress and anxiety | Sertraline, Fluoxetine |
| Antihypertensives | Reduce high blood pressure | Lisinopril, Amlodipine |
| Analgesics | Alleviate pain | Oxycodone, Acetaminophen |
| Antipsychotics | Treat extreme mental health conditions | Risperidone, Quetiapine |
| Hormonal Therapies | Replace or supplement hormones | Levothyroxine, Estrogen |
| Anticoagulants | Prevent blood clotting | Warfarin, Apixaban |

Drug Interactions
It's vital for clients to inform their healthcare supplier about all medications they are taking, consisting of over-the-counter drugs and supplements. Drug interactions can enhance negative effects or decrease the effectiveness of treatments.

Frequently Asked Questions About Prescription Drugs
1. How do I know if a prescription drug is ideal for me?
Your doctor will examine your case history, present health status, and specific symptoms to identify the most appropriate medication. Constantly do not hesitate to ask questions for clarity.
2. Can I stop taking my prescription medication suddenly?
It is important to consult your doctor before making any modifications to medication routines. Some medications require steady tapering to prevent withdrawal symptoms.
3. What should I do if I miss out on a dose?
If a dose is missed out on, follow the guidelines offered by your physician or the medication's product packaging. Usually, take the missed out on dosage as quickly as you keep in mind unless it's nearly time for the next dose.
4. Exist generic versions of prescription drugs?
Yes, numerous prescription drugs have generic equivalents that can be more economical without compromising effectiveness. Discuss this choice with your doctor or pharmacist.
5. What are the indications of an allergic reaction to a medication?
Indications may include rash, itching, swelling, difficulty breathing, or gastrointestinal distress. If you experience these symptoms, look for instant medical attention.
